2004 Stellenbosch Sauvignon Blanc

Broken Stone Sauvignon Blanc from the beautiful Stellenbosch region delivers a vibrant and expressive showcase of this renowned varietal. This vintage white wine presents a refreshing profile, boasting a light-bodied structure that gracefully balances its lively acidity. The nose is brimming with aromas of citrus and green apple, complemented by subtle herbal notes that add complexity. On the palate, the wine reveals a mouthwatering intensity that enhances its clean, crisp character. Its pronounced fruitiness harmonizes beautifully with a dry finish, making it an inviting choice for a variety of occasions. With its exceptional quality, this Sauvignon Blanc reflects the distinct terroir of Stellenbosch, making it a delightful experience for any wine enthusiast.

Region:


Stellenbosch

Stellenbosch is the heart and soul of South African wine, as important to the country's winemaking prestige as Napa is to the United States or Bordeaux to France. This beautiful region comprises seven sub-regions, all centered around the leafy university town of Stellenbosch. Winemaking here is influenced by the cooling sea breezes that sweep in off False Bay, and the crumbly, mineral-rich granite soils. While perhaps most famous for its beloved Pinotage, Stellenbosch also offers a diverse range of varietals, such as its impeccable Bordeaux blends, fragrant Syrah, crisp Chenin Blanc and outstanding Chardonnay.
